Spring aop 拦截 controller
Web对于如何让spring框架扫描到AOP,本文也不作说明。 情况一: 一个方法只被一个Aspect类拦截. 当一个方法只被一个Aspect拦截时,这个Aspect中的不同advice是按照怎样的顺序进 … WebJoinpoint(连接点):所谓连接点是指那些被拦截到的点。在spring中,这些点指的是方法,因为spring只支持方法类型的连接点 ... 深入理解Spring AOP之二代理对象生成 spring代理对象 上一篇博客中讲到了Spring的一些基本概念和初步讲了实现方法,当中提到了动态代理技 …
Spring aop 拦截 controller
Did you know?
Web拦截器. 所有HandlerMapping实现都支持处理程序拦截器,当您要将特定功能应用于某些请求时,这些拦截器非常有用 - 例如,检查主体。拦截器必须实现HandlerInterceptor,实现三种方法,这些方法应该提供足够的灵活性来进行各种预处理和后处理: Web13 Apr 2024 · MethodInterceptor:是 AOP 项目中的拦截器(注:不是动态代理拦截器),区别于 HandlerInterceptor 拦截目标时请求,它拦截的目标是方法。 ... 的 Method 的 …
Webaop思想: AOP(Aspect Oriented Programming)是一种面向切面的编程思想。 面向切面编程是将程序抽象成各个切面,即解剖对象的内部,将那些影响了多个类的公共行为抽取到一个可重用模块里,减少系统的重复代码,降低模块间的耦合度,增强代码的可操作性和可维护性。 Web13 Apr 2024 · 版权. Spring boot 专栏收录该内容. 6 篇文章 0 订阅. 订阅专栏. 文章介绍了 Spring Boot中实现通用 Auth 的四种方式,包括传统AOP、拦截器、参数解析器和过滤器,并提供了对应的实例代码,最后简单总结了下它们的执行顺序,供大家参考学习。.
Web1 Feb 2024 · 2、方案. 基于JAVA注解+AOP切面方式实现防止重复提交,一般需要自定义JAVA注解,采用AOP切面解析注解,实现接口首次请求提交时,将接口请求标记(由接口签名、请求token、请求客户端ip等组成)存储至redis,并设置超时时间T(T时间之后redis清除接口请求标记 ... Web25 Apr 2024 · Spring AOP 实现拦截Controller中的方法. 因为Spring的Bean扫描和Spring-MVC的Bean扫描是分开的, 两者的Bean位于两个不同的Application, 而且Spring-MVC …
WebSpringBoot-AOP请求拦截自定义注解用在Controller类上和Controller方法上都生效; Springboot 切面AOP动态获取自定义注解; SpringBoot-AOP请求拦截(类似基类控制器) SpringBoot-返回数据中null字段不显示; Springboot-整合Freemarker; SpringBoot使用pageHelper实现分页查询; SpringBoot-整合Shiro补充 ...
Web13 Mar 2024 · Spring使用AOP. 基本过程如下: 在配置类上添加@EnableAspectJAutoProxy注解,启用AspectJ自动代理。 创建一个切面类,并且在该类上使用@Aspect注解来标识该类为切面类。 在切面类中定义一个或多个切点,用来匹配需要拦截 … fish mackerel saltedWeb14 Apr 2024 · 众所周知,Spring拥有两大特性:IoC和AOP。Spring核心容器的主要组件是Bean工厂(BeanFactory),Bean工厂使用控制反转(IoC)模式来降低程序代码之间的 … fish mackerel in cansWeb补充:关于在Service层和Controller层进行Aop拦截的配置 (如果不生效需要注意配置的配置以及扫描的位置) 一般我们将扫描@Service写在applicationContext.xml。 因此在applicationContext.xml配置的AOP自动代理对@Service层的注解有效,如果我们需要在Controller层实现注解AOP,我们需要 ... can clorox wipes be used on a phoneWeb在我们的web系统中,经常有统计API请求时间的需求。本文通过Spring AOP的方式来解决该问题,并给出具体代码实现。. 原理讲解. 使用AOP拦截所有Controller层的方法,定义一个环绕通知,在代理的方法(Controller里的方法)执行前后记录时间戳,并在执行后打印方法执 … can clorox wipes be used on handsWeb12 Jul 2024 · [JAVA]spring-aop拦截controller以及service方法 为了方便调试记录使用的参数,使用AOP将controller 以及service包下的方法做切面拦截所有的方法package … can clorox wipes be used on leather walletWeb19 Feb 2024 · mybatis-spring-boot-starter; Spring AOP两种代理. jdk代理 使用Java动态代理来创建AOP代理,在程序运行期间由JVM根据反射等机制动态的生成(当然此接口要有实现类)。 cglib代理 代理类不是接口时,Spring会切换为使用CGLIB代理,它的工作原理是:直接在class字节码文件添加 ... can clorox wipes make you sickWeb23 Sep 2016 · spring 关于注解的配置如下: AOP 的 拦截 类如下: (刚开始execution写的是本人项目包的 controller 类,后来百度说什么 controller 比较特殊,要用下面这样子,结 … fish mackinaw